কম্পিউটার

HTML DOM ইনপুট তারিখ অবজেক্ট


HTML DOM ইনপুট তারিখ অবজেক্ট টাইপ তারিখ সহ একটি ইনপুট HTML উপাদান উপস্থাপন করে।

সিনট্যাক্স

নিম্নলিখিত সিনট্যাক্স −

  • একটি তৈরি করা হচ্ছে টাইপ তারিখ সহ
var dateObject = document.createElement(“input”);
dateObject.type = “date”;

গুণাবলী

এখানে, “dateObject” নিম্নলিখিত বৈশিষ্ট্য থাকতে পারে -

গুণাবলী বিবরণ
স্বয়ংক্রিয়ভাবে সম্পূর্ণ এটি একটি তারিখ ক্ষেত্রের স্বয়ংসম্পূর্ণ বৈশিষ্ট্যের মান নির্ধারণ করে
অটোফোকাস তারিখ ক্ষেত্রটি প্রাথমিক পৃষ্ঠা লোডের উপর ফোকাস করা উচিত কিনা তা নির্ধারণ করে।
ডিফল্ট মান এটি তারিখ ক্ষেত্রের ডিফল্ট মান সেট/রিটার্ন করে
অক্ষম তারিখ ক্ষেত্র নিষ্ক্রিয়/সক্ষম হলে তা নির্ধারণ করে
ফর্ম এটি এনক্লোজিং ফর্মের একটি রেফারেন্স প্রদান করে যাতে তারিখ ক্ষেত্র রয়েছে
সর্বোচ্চ এটি তারিখ ক্ষেত্রের সর্বাধিক বৈশিষ্ট্যের মান প্রদান করে/সেট করে
মিনিট এটি তারিখ ক্ষেত্রের ন্যূনতম বৈশিষ্ট্যের মান প্রদান করে/সেট করে
নাম এটি একটি তারিখ ক্ষেত্রের নামের বৈশিষ্ট্যের মান নির্ধারণ করে
Only read তারিখ ক্ষেত্রটি শুধুমাত্র পঠিত কিনা তা নির্ধারণ করে
প্রয়োজনীয় ফর্মটি জমা দেওয়ার জন্য তারিখ ক্ষেত্রটি পূরণ করা বাধ্যতামূলক কিনা তা নির্ধারণ করে
পদক্ষেপ এটি তারিখ ক্ষেত্রের ধাপের বৈশিষ্ট্যের মান নির্ধারণ করে
টাইপ এটি তারিখ ক্ষেত্রের ফর্ম উপাদানের ধরন প্রদান করে
মান এটি তারিখ ক্ষেত্রের মান বৈশিষ্ট্যের মান নির্ধারণ করে

বুলিয়ান মান

এবং, এছাড়াও নিম্নলিখিত পদ্ধতিগুলি -

বুলিয়ান ভ্যালু বিশদ বিবরণ
পদক্ষেপ তারিখ ক্ষেত্রটি কত দিন বৃদ্ধি পাবে তা নির্ধারণ করে।
স্টেপআপ
তারিখ ক্ষেত্রটি কত দিন বৃদ্ধি পাবে তা নির্ধারণ করে।

উদাহরণ

আসুনইনপুট তারিখ সর্বাধিক এর একটি উদাহরণ দেখি সম্পত্তি -

<!DOCTYPE html>
<html>
<head>
<title>Input Date Max</title>
</head>
<body>
<form>
Date Select: <input type="date" id="date" name="DateSelect" max="2018-12-31">
</form>
<button onclick="getMaxDate()">Change Max Date</button>
<div id="divDisplay"></div>
<script>
   var inputDate = document.getElementById("date");
   var divDisplay = document.getElementById("divDisplay");
   divDisplay.textContent = 'Max of date input: '+inputDate.max;
   function getMaxDate() {
      var oldInputDate = inputDate.max;
      inputDate.max = '2020-12-31';
      divDisplay.textContent = 'Max of date input: '+inputDate.max;
   }
</script>
</body>
</html>

আউটপুট

এটি নিম্নলিখিত আউটপুট −

তৈরি করবে

'সর্বোচ্চ তারিখ পরিবর্তন করুন' ক্লিক করার আগে বোতাম -

HTML DOM ইনপুট তারিখ অবজেক্ট

'সর্বোচ্চ তারিখ পরিবর্তন করুন' ক্লিক করার পর বোতাম -

HTML DOM ইনপুট তারিখ অবজেক্ট


  1. HTML DOM ইনপুট রিসেট অবজেক্ট

  2. HTML DOM ইনপুট সার্চ অবজেক্ট

  3. HTML DOM ইনপুট টেক্সট অবজেক্ট

  4. HTML DOM ইনপুট পাসওয়ার্ড অবজেক্ট